This verse reminds us that human beings can be ungrateful when hardship strikes.
وَإِن تُصِبۡهُمۡ سَيِّئَةُۢ بِمَا قَدَّمَتۡ أَيۡدِيهِمۡ فَإِنَّ ٱلۡإِنسَٰنَ كَفُورٞ
But if evil afflicts them for what their hands have put forth, then indeed, man is ungrateful.
Quran, Ash-Shura 42:48
The verse describes a human reaction: when facing difficulty, we often forget the blessings we have. It specifies that this hardship is related to our own deeds. This invites us to reflect on our attitude. In our daily life, when a setback occurs, we can choose to focus on what we lack rather than what we have. Gratitude means recognizing Allah's blessings, even in tough times.
